Table 7-2. Instrument Troubleshooting (Continued)
Possible Cause
14.p Defective relay.
14.q Defective 67CFR regulator, supply pressure gauge
jumps around.
15.a Configuration errors.
15.b Feedback arm bent/damaged or bias spring
missing/damaged.
15.c Feedback arm loose on travel sensor.
15.d Travel sensor mis-adjusted.
15.e Cables not plugged into PWB correctly.
15.f Broken travel sensor wire(s).
15.g Open travel sensor.
15.h Travel sensor "frozen", will not turn.
16.a Defective pressure sensor(s).
16.b Pressure sensor O-ring(s) missing.
17.a Instrument does not have proper tiering.
18.a PlantWeb alerts in firmware 1.5 and higher are
mode-based. Transducer block mode may be in MAN
or OOS.
19.a Battery pack not charged.
Action
14.p Depress relay beam at adjustment location in
shroud, look for increase in output pressure. Remove
relay, inspect relay seal. Replace relay seal or relay if
I/P converter ass'y good and air passages not blocked
(refer to Replacing the Pneumatic Relay on page
7-8). Check relay adjustment (refer to page 5-4 of the
Calibration Section).
14.q Replace 67CFR regulator.
15.a Verify configuration.
15.b Replace feedback arm and bias spring (see the
Maintenance section). Perform Device Setup (see
page 3-2 of the Basic Setup Section).
15.c Perform Travel Sensor Calibration procedure
(refer to the Travel Sensor section on page 7-10).
15.d Perform Travel Sensor calibration procedure
(refer to the Travel Sensor section on page 7-10).
15.e Inspect connections and correct.
15.f Inspect wires for broken solder joint at pot
or broken wire. Replace travel sensor (refer to the
Travel Sensor section on page 7-10).
15.g Check for continuity in electrical travel range. If
necessary, replace travel sensor (refer to the Travel
Sensor section on page 7-10).
15.h Rotate feedback arm to ensure it moves freely.
If not, replace the travel sensor (refer to the Travel
Sensor section on page 7-10).
16.a Replace PWB (see Replacing the PWB
Assembly on page 7-7).
16.b Replace O-ring(s).
17.a Upgrade tiering.
18.a Check transducer block mode. Change to AUTO
if appropriate.
19.a Charge battery pack.
Note: Battery pack can be charged while attached to
the Field communicator or separately. The 475 Field
Communicator is fully operable while the battery pack
is charging. Do not attempt to charge the battery pack
in a hazardous area.
